Islamabad: Additional and Sessions Court in Islamabad Wednesday indicted Pakistan Tehreek-e-Insaf (PTI) chairman Imran Khan in Tosha Khana case, GNN reported.
According to details, additional session judge Humayun Dilawar heard the case and rejected the petition of Imran’s lawyers to replace the judge to hear this case.
The case was heard in police headquarters.
Imran Khan has boycotted the proceeding of indictment in Tosha Khana case.
